Godspeed, Chad.
While I never had the chance to spend a great deal of time with Chad, we often had a chance to b.s. at various R Gruppe gatherings (he was a SoCal member). Chad was a very, very nice man, with a kind and generous heart. He spent a good deal of time working with and supporting the California Boys Republic, a charity his father was involved with as well.
I believe his health issues began with that heavy crash at Daytona in about 2006, 2007, or 2008 (I can't remember which year exactly). He suffered some pretty traumatic injuries, being held in the hospital for many, many months before being released. I think he may have suffered the same concussive injury that has been widely discussed in the context of NFL players.
*Sigh*. We are the same age. He's leaving behind a family that loves him, and that he loved dearly. Count your blessings, folks, and make every day count...
